How much do entrylevel bank fraud investigator j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for entrylevel bank fraud investigator in the United States is $30.83,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$22.12 and $35.34 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Entrylevel Bank Fraud Investigator vs Entry-level Financial Crime Analyst?

AspectEntrylevel Bank Fraud InvestigatorEntry-level Financial Crime Analyst
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er certifications like ACAMSHigh school diploma; certifications like ACAMS or CFE are advantageous
Work EnvironmentBank branches, call centers, or remoteFinancial institutions, government agencies, or consulting firms
Industry UsagePrimarily banking and financial servicesBanking, finance, and regulatory sectors
Job FocusDetecting and investigating bank fraud casesAnalyzing financial crimes, including fraud, money laundering, and suspicious activities

While both roles involve financial crime detection, the Entrylevel Bank Fraud Investigator primarily focuses on investigating bank-specific fraud cases, whereas the Entry-level Financial Crime Analyst has a broader scope, including analyzing various financial crimes across sectors.

Zions Bancorporation is currently accepting applications for a Digital Banking Fraud Analyst. This position is in-office in Midvale, UT. The schedule will be Monday-Friday 9:00 am-6:00 pm MDT.

The ideal candidate for this position will have the skills and experience necessary to:

  • Monitor and review the fraud risk, unique or highly complex exceptions generated from various fraud prevention systems, filters, and exception files.

  • Identify, prevent, and mitigate digital banking, mobile, electronic, and/or ACH banking fraud losses.

  • Conduct research and analysis, prepare management report, and make recommendations to senior officers.

  • Work through high volumes of potential alerts to confirm limited actual fraud events.

  • Research digital banking access logs to identify unauthorized access and/or transactions.

  • Assist digital banking customers with malware infected computers or other access devices.

  • Handle inbound and outbound fraud and malware related calls with customers and other financial institutions.

  • Perform other duties as assigned.

The position also supports the implementation and daily operations of Zelle. Ensures smooth workflows, monitors transactions, and maintains compliance with network rules and regulations.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Monitor Zelle transactions, review tokens, fraud, and disputes.

  • Track fraud trends, disputes, complaints.

  • Maintain documentation for procedures, fraud response, and dispute resolution.

  • Support fraud investigations and audit requests.

  • Provide research and analysis for Zelle-related projects.

Qualifications:

  • Requires a bachelor's degree in a related field and 2+ years of financial services experience with fraud and/or information security processes and procedures, preferably in an online banking fraud prevention, detection, and mitigation area.

    • A combination of education and experience may meet requirements.

  • Working knowledge of loss and fraud detection/prevention principles, compliance and regulatory issues related to the department and/or company.

  • Working knowledge of fraud and digital banking systems and detection tools.

  • Zelle-related experience.

  • Demonstrates strong communication skills both written and verbal.

  • Possess skills needed to conduct client phone interviews to identify fraud/scams.

  • Knowledge and experience with root cause analysis.

  • Solid analytical, interpretive, and problem-solving skills.

  • Participate in process improvement idea generation.

  • Ability to use various software applications.

  • Works to meet tight deadlines to mitigate loss.
